BEVERLEY JEANETTE FEHR March 2, 1947 - September 27, 2016 It is with great sadness that we announce the sudden passing of our mother, sister, aunt, grandmother and friend, Beverley Jeanette Fehr (nee Martens). Bev will be lovingly remembered by daughters: Gloria (Jim) Laurendeau and their three children of Calgary; Gwenda (Todd) MacPherson and their four children of Warman, SK; sister Elaine (Michael) Filkins and their three children and families from Jasper, Georgia; brother Ron (Mary) Martens of Memphis, Tennessee and son Tim and family of Abbotsford, BC; brother Harvey (Lily) of Vancouver, BC, and many extended family members and friends. Bev will be remembered for her love of music, particularly playing the piano/organ and singing in the choir at church. Our hearts are full with the outpouring of love and support surrounding us during this difficult time. A very special thank you to Pastor Bruce Martin and the staff of Calvary Temple for going out of their way to honour Mom and so willingly set aside time to remember with us. Thanks also go to the Bardal Funeral Chapel for helping to make all arrangements from afar during this difficult time. A memorial service will be held on Sunday, October 2 from 2:30 p.m. to 3:30 p.m. in the Buntain Chapel at Calvary Temple. Refreshments will be served.
